Understanding Texture Sensitivity in Autism and Its Impact on Sleep

Texture sensitivity in autism often stems from sensory processing differences, where everyday fabrics feel like sandpaper. Common triggers include seams, tags, and coarse weaves, leading to discomfort, anxiety, and disrupted sleep cycles. Recent studies from leading autism organizations highlight that optimized bedding can improve sleep duration by 30-50% for these individuals.

Key challenges:

  • Rough or bumpy surfaces causing irritation.
  • Seams and labels that scratch during movement.
  • Synthetic fibers trapping heat and feeling sticky.

Choosing autism-friendly bedding means prioritizing hypoallergenic, seamless designs that soothe rather than stimulate. Next, we'll explore must-have features.

Essential Features of the Best Bedding for Texture-Sensitive Autistic Sleepers

To select top-tier options, focus on these proven elements:

Feature Why It Matters Top Recommendations
Smooth Fabrics Minimizes friction; feels like silk on skin. Bamboo viscose, Tencel lyocell, micro-modal.
Seamless Construction Eliminates ridges and tags for uninterrupted comfort. Tagless sheets, flat-felled seams.
Breathability Regulates temperature to prevent overheating. High thread count (300+), moisture-wicking materials.
Hypoallergenic Reduces allergens that exacerbate sensitivities. Oeko-Tex certified, organic cotton alternatives.
Weight and Pressure Provides deep pressure for calming effect. Weighted blankets (5-15% body weight), light duvets.

Buying Guide: How to Choose Texture-Sensitive Sheets That Last

  1. Test Samples: Order swatches from Amazon or brand sites to feel textures firsthand.
  2. Check Certifications: GOTS organic or OEKO-TEX ensure no harsh chemicals.
  3. Size Matters: Deep pockets (16"+) prevent slipping, reducing frustration.
  4. Layer Smart: Start with a mattress protector, then sheets, duvet, and blanket.
  5. Maintenance: Cold wash, low dry to preserve softness.

FAQ: Best Bedding for Texture-Sensitive Autistic Sleepers

What fabrics should texture-sensitive autistic sleepers avoid?

Fleece, wool, and low-quality polyester—too rough or staticky.

Are weighted blankets safe for autism?

Yes, when 10% of body weight and supervised for young children. 🏆

How often replace sensory bedding?

Every 2-3 years for peak softness.

Best thread count for sensitivity?

300-500; higher can feel stiff.
